Operational Performance and Supply Chain Risk Assessment in SME Vannamei Shrimp Farming

Muhammad Tri Putra Utomo Noorhan Firdaus Pambudi
Jul 2026 · Journal of Management and Creative Business · Vol 4, pp. 790-803 · 0 citations

Abstract

Small and medium-sized enterprise (SME) shrimp farms play an important role in Indonesia’s aquaculture sector; however, many continue to experience operational inefficiencies, rising production costs, and supply chain vulnerabilities that reduce profitability and long-term sustainability. Existing studies have examined individual operational challenges in aquaculture, yet few have adopted an integrated framework capable of simultaneously diagnosing performance gaps and prioritizing operational risks. This study addresses this gap by integrating the Supply Chain Operations Reference (SCOR) model and Failure Mode and Effects Analysis (FMEA) to evaluate operational performance and supply chain risks in three vannamei shrimp farming SMEs located in Tegal, Central Java. A qualitative multiple-case study approach was employed using interviews, field observations, operational records, SCOR process mapping, and FMEA risk assessment. The findings reveal that the most significant weaknesses are concentrated in the internally focused SCOR attributes of Cost and Asset Management, while Reliability, Responsiveness, and Agility generally perform better. Farm C demonstrated the strongest overall operational performance due to disciplined operational practices, structured data management, supplier diversification, and systematic monitoring systems. FMEA analysis identified high-priority risks associated with night-time dissolved oxygen control, post-harvest turnaround delays, feed management, inventory handling, and operational data management. The integration of SCOR and FMEA provides complementary insights whereby SCOR identifies performance deficiencies while FMEA prioritizes their underlying causes. This study contributes to the literature by demonstrating the applicability of a combined SCOR–FMEA framework in aquaculture SMEs and provides practical recommendations for improving operational efficiency, supply chain resilience, and farm profitability.

Resilient Supply Chain Capabilities and SMEs Performance in South-East Nigeria

Small and medium enterprises (SMEs) operate in supply environments characterised by uncertainty, resource constraints and recurring disruptions. In such environments, the capacity to adapt operations, manage supply chain risks and deploy technology strategically may determine whether firms maintain performance or experience prolonged operational difficulties. This study examined the effects of supply chain flexibility, supply chain risk management and supply chain technology adoption on the performance of SMEs in South-East Nigeria. The study adopted a quantitative survey design and analysed data obtained from 325 valid SME responses. Structural equation modelling was used to evaluate the measurement and structural models. The findings show that supply chain flexibility has a significant positive effect on SME performance (β = 0.30, p < 0.001). Supply chain risk management emerged as the strongest predictor of performance, with a significant positive effect (β = 0.37, p < 0.001). However, supply chain technology adoption did not have a significant direct effect on SME performance (β = –0.05, p = 0.52). The findings suggest that adaptive and risk-oriented capabilities have more immediate performance implications for SMEs than technology adoption considered in isolation. The study argues that technology should be integrated with organisational capabilities and supply chain processes rather than treated as an automatic route to improved performance. The article contributes to supply chain resilience research by examining the combined effects of operational adaptability, risk management and technology adoption within the SME context of South-East Nigeria. Practical implications are provided for SME managers, policymakers and supply chain practitioners.

Analysis sustainability industry fishery catch scale small in Indragiri Hilir Regency

The small-scale capture fisheries industry plays a crucial role in improving the welfare of coastal communities in Indragiri Hilir Regency, but faces several challenges, including supply chain and operational risks. Therefore, this study aims to analyze supply chain performance and sustainability using the Supply Chain Operations Reference (SCOR) approach and identify and mitigate risks using the House of Risk (HOR) phase 1 and phase 2 method. The study location is in Mandah, Kuala Indragiri, Congcong, and Tanah Merah districts.The SCOR analysis results indicate that supply chain performance is in the low to moderate category, with major weaknesses in the make, deliver, and return processes, particularly related to technological limitations, quality of catch handling, and distribution. The HOR 1 analysis identified key sources of risk, namely limited cold storage facilities, dependence on middlemen, bad weather, and lack of market information. Furthermore, HOR 2 resulted in priority mitigation strategies such as digitizing price and weather information, strengthening fishing institutions, and increasing capacity in post-harvest handling. Overall, improving the sustainability of this industry requires an integrated approach through improved supply chain performance and systematic risk management.

Risk Management & Supply-Chain Continuity —Case Study: SPDC

Supply chain continuity is a major priority for organisations operating in high-risk and volatile environments, particularly within the oil and gas sector. The Shell Petroleum Development Company (SPDC), operating in Nigeria’s Niger Delta, contends with persistent operational challenges such as pipeline vandalism, crude oil theft, militant disruptions, environmental hazards, and regulatory uncertainties. These conditions create frequent interruptions across the supply chain, highlighting the need for a robust risk management framework capable of sustaining uninterrupted operations. This study investigates the relationship between Risk Identification and Assessment (RIA), Mitigation, Response and Recovery (MRR), and supply chain continuity within SPDC. A quantitative research methodology was employed using a survey research design. The target population comprised SPDC as an organisation, with the unit of analysis centred on core operational departments responsible for risk management and supply chain operations. Staff representatives from these key departments were selected to provide organisational-level insights. An estimated organisational population of 150 positions across the relevant units was identified, from which a stratified sample representing 50% of this structure (75 respondents) was drawn. Data were gathered using a structured questionnaire consisting of four sections: organisational demographic information, RIA practices, MRR practices, and supply chain continuity outcomes. A 5-point Likert scale was used to measure organisational perceptions and practices. Content validity was achieved through expert review by academics and industry practitioners, while reliability analysis produced Cronbach’s alpha coefficients between 0.79 and 0.87, indicating strong internal consistency. Descriptive statistics, correlation analysis, and multiple regression techniques were used to examine the relationships and predictive effects among the variables. Findings revealed that SPDC demonstrates high levels of RIA and MRR practices, with mean scores of 3.94 and 4.02 respectively. Correlation results showed strong positive relationships between RIA and supply chain continuity (r = .713, p < .05), and between MRR and continuity (r = .745, p < .01). Regression analysis confirmed that both RIA (β = .381, p < .001) and MRR (β = .476, p < .001) significantly predict supply chain continuity, jointly accounting for 65.9% of the variance (R² = .659). The study concludes that integrating proactive risk identification with effective mitigation, response, and recovery mechanisms enhances organisational resilience and sustains supply chain continuity in the challenging environment of the Niger Delta. The results underscore the importance of continuous improvement in risk management processes tailored to dynamic socio-political and operational conditions.

Design of Key Performance Indicators (KPIs) for the Management of Poultry Supply Chains

Supply chain management must balance multiple objectives, as resilience to disruptions and the ability to deliver finished products regularly, which is an essential value-added for many customers. Achieving this regularity requires specific Key Performance Indicators (KPIs). In Agri-food Supply Chains (AFCs), these KPIs are influenced by biological constraints that determine the duration of production stages. This study identifies KPIs for managing a vertically integrated poultry AFCs. To this end, we developed a Systems Dynamics (SD) model that integrates breeder management, incubation processes, feed requirements, and sales activities with the associated cost and revenue structures. The model uses delays, nonlinearities, and feedback mechanisms, and allows for optimization, sensitivity analysis, and Monte Carlo simulation. This research contributes to the Operations Research literature by providing a decision-support tool for designing more robust, resilient and efficient AFCs. Finally, the proposed KPIs help managers anticipate how disruptions propagate through the system and how they affect profit and deliveries to customers, necessary to comply with European NFRD and CSRD regulations.

Supply Chain Risk Management Practices: The Strategic Pathways to Enhanced Sustainability Performance of Ghanaian Firms

This study examines how supply chain risk management (SCRM) practices influence the sustainability performance (SUSP) of Ghanaian manufacturing SMEs. Focusing on five key dimensions—Risk Identification (RID), Risk Assessment (RA), Risk Mitigation (RM), Risk Continuous Improvement (RCI), and Risk Performance (RP) evaluation — the research uses a quantitative approach with data from 304 firms in Ghana’s Ashanti Region. Data were collected via structured questionnaires and analysed using Partial Least Squares Structural Equation Modeling (PLS- SEM) using SmartPLS software. The results show that all five SCRM dimensions have a significant and positive impact on sustainability outcomes, with Risk Performance having the greatest impact. The study concludes that SMEs adopting comprehensive and structured risk management practices are more likely to achieve environmental, social, and economic sustainability while strengthening their operational resilience. Therefore, SMEs should integrate comprehensive risk identification mechanisms, adopt structured risk assessment frameworks, institutionalise coordinated risk management systems, cultivate a continuous improvement culture, and develop performance indicators to monitor the effectiveness of risk management as strategic pathways to enhanced sustainability performance

Value chain analysis and business model development of the Rizal mango growers agriculture cooperative

Agricultural cooperatives play a critical role in improving the productivity, market access, and economic resilience of smallholder farmers. Despite their importance, many cooperatives continue to experience operational inefficiencies that limit value creation and long-term competitiveness. This study analyzed the value chain of the Rizal Mango Growers Agriculture Cooperative (RMGAC) in Rizal, Cagayan, Philippines, using Porter’s Value Chain Analysis and developed a Business Model Canvas to translate operational findings into strategic business interventions. A qualitative descriptive case study was conducted using key informant interviews, field observations, and document review. Data were analyzed through thematic analysis and organized according to Porter’s primary and support activities. The findings identified several organizational strengths, including strong institutional partnerships, collective procurement, technical assistance, and active member participation. However, constraints such as inconsistent input availability, limited adoption of recommended orchard management practices, inadequate postharvest facilities, high transportation costs, and limited value-added processing continue to reduce product quality and profitability. Based on these findings, a Business Model Canvas was developed to guide strategic improvements through strengthened partnerships, improved production and postharvest management, market diversification, infrastructure development, and value-added processing. The study demonstrates that integrating Porter’s Value Chain Analysis with the Business Model Canvas provides a practical framework for converting operational assessment into strategic business planning. This integrated approach offers a useful decision-support tool for agricultural cooperatives seeking to improve competitiveness, organizational sustainability, and value creation in smallholder farming systems.
